Some record that fan is making for himself. *POEM* This Dept. will reprint a poem each issue, with due acknowledgement from source: Not being used for professional use, nor sale, this is not PLAGARISM: REVELATION By V. R. Eberhart Enrapt, I gaze, where space lies heaped in space / Into the ice-hung silence of the Void. / Where myriad stars and worlds glow brilliantly / Against the deep, black velvet of the heavens. / All thought lies hushed, before that rich display / Still sparkling with the lustre first approved / By the great Lapidary. And how He flung them out, in ages past! / With careless, generous hand, he scattered them. / Till all of space will filled with shinning worlds. / Their dazzling decorations gleamed and glittered / And flashed a brightness 'tween the walls of night / And to His beauty-loving eyes, through aeons since / Have given delight. Then sudden brief more swift that thought / A flash across the dark - a world has gone! / Dropping softly from its place with silent speed / Vanishing all-deep-swallowed is the maw / Of relms illuminated. And, I stand / FINITE before the INFINITE, and in that flash / Of little time, I READ ETERNITY. This concludes: Volume 1, Number 1 of Salute.
